Belm - Ostercappeln Loop
A road cycling route starting from Belm
Embark on an epic road cycling adventure from Belm to Ostercappeln, taking in scenic routes and cultural highlights along the way.
Map
![Map miniature of "Belm - Ostercappeln Loop" cycling inspiration in Weser-Ems, Germany. Generated by Tarmacs.app cycling route planner](https://images.tarmacs.app/cycling-routes/routemaps/600/germany/weser-ems/belm/road/298544.webp)
Set off from Belm and embark on an epic road cycling adventure through picturesque landscapes up to Ostercappeln. This challenging route spans 83 kilometers and includes 569 meters of ascents. Suitable for experienced amateur cyclists, the terrain will test your endurance and reward you with breathtaking views. Along the way, discover highlights such as Hohenhorst, an idyllic spot for a break, and Schiplage - St. Annen, offering historical charm. Conclude your journey with a triumphant return to Belm.
